Very strong financial profile and conservative financial policies; Top market positions in athletic footwear and apparel; Broad geographic diversity; and Consistently solid operating performance. Exposure to changing consumer preferences and intense worldwide competition in the athletic footwear and apparel industry; Vulnerable to global economic downturns and foreign currency risk; significant influence and substantial control by the company's co-founder and chairman of the board The ratings on Beaverton, Ore.-based NIKE Inc. reflect Standard&Poor's Ratings Services' view that the company's business risk profile (as defined by our criteria) continues to be "strong," with top market positions in its core global markets, good geographic diversification, and solid operating performance through the recent recession.
